Feb 02, 2013 · --Officers are people who go out into the world and conduct and manage intelligence operations. Despite what you've heard in movies or bad reporting, these guys aren't "agents." An agent is a person--typically a foreign national--who the CIA bribes, bullies, or otherwise convinces to spy on his own country or some group. Officers manage agents. Getting hired by the Central Intelligence Agency (CIA) is a time consuming process. The application alone will take two months to more than a year to process.
